About the role
Accord is seeking a mission-driven Waiver Case Management (WCM) to join a team of Case Managers in making a difference in the lives of people living with disabilities. The WCM will evaluate, create, and support the health and human service needs of people that Accord serves. This is a hybrid role with offices located in Midway St. Paul, MN. The WCM will be expected to travel within the community to meet with supported persons. Staff will work on-site during training and orientation.
Responsibilities
- Develop a community support plan and goals for each person on an assigned caseload
- Meet with each person regularly to evaluate progress and needed changes
- Develop person-center service agreements, with the person, to authorize services to meet the person's assessed needs and goals
- Document changes and adjustments
- Authorize services to meet the person's assessed needs and goals
- Comply with MN Health Care Programs in delivery of waivered services (such as CADI, BI, EW, DD)
- Work with assessors to complete MnChoices assessments
